To
prevent child trafficking, the Department of Social Welfare
and Development (DSWD) has been tasked to issue a travel clearance
to any individual below 18 years of age traveling abroad alone
or with someone other than his/her parents.
|
|
|
A
minor traveling abroad with either or only one parent
is no longer needed. The travel clearance is issued
as a measure to prevent child trafficking.
Requirements
for application of travel clearance include a duly accomplished
application form, photocopy of the birth certificate
or passport of the minor, a written consent of both
parents or the solo parent or the legal guardian permitting
the minor to travel alone to a foreign country, photocopy
of the marriage certificate of the minor's parents,
and two passport-size colored photos of the minor taken
within the last six months.

Parents,
legal guardians or duly authorized representatives may file
their travel clearance application at the Bohol SWAD Team
Office at 21 CPG East Avenue, Tagbilaran City or call telephone
numbers 411-4991 or 501-9365. (Papiasa B. Bustrillos/SWO III)
